| Opplysninger | Innhold: Movement and mobility in the Neolithic / Jim Leary and Thomas Kador -- Varied mobility in the Neolithic : the Linearbandkeramik on the move / Penny Bickle -- Resourcing Stonehenge : patterns of human, animal and goods mobility in the late neolithic / Benjamin Chan, Sarah Viner, Mike Parker Pearson, Umberto Albarella and Rob Ixer -- Movement and thresholds : architecture and landscape at the Carrowkeel-Keshcorran passage tomb complex, Co. Sligo, Ireland / Sam Moore -- Monuments to mobility? : investigating cursus patterning in southern Britain / Roy Loveday -- Routeways of the Neolithic / Fiona Haughey -- Coastal connections : coastal mobility in the Neolithic / Alice Rogers -- Should I stay or should I go? : movement and mobility in the Hebridean Neolithic / Angela Gannon -- Scattered in time and space : ploughzone lithics and mobility in the Neolithic / Jonathan Last -- The social construction of place, mobility and stone in Neolithic south-west Britain : a case study from Mendip / Clive Jonathon Bond.
